Heim >Web-Frontend >js-Tutorial >JS-Methode zum Anzeigen von Zeilenumbrüchen in den Fähigkeiten „alert_javascript'.

JS-Methode zum Anzeigen von Zeilenumbrüchen in den Fähigkeiten „alert_javascript'.

WBOY
WBOYOriginal
2016-05-16 15:25:001477Durchsuche

Das Beispiel in diesem Artikel beschreibt die Methode zum Anzeigen von Zeilenumbrüchen in Warnungen mithilfe von JS. Teilen Sie es als Referenz mit allen. Die Details lauten wie folgt:
Lassen Sie uns zunächst eine kompliziertere Methode vorstellen, die jedoch zur Unterscheidung jedes Browsermodells verwendet werden kann:

//浏览器类型判定
function getOs()
{
  if(navigator.userAgent.indexOf("MSIE")>0) {
     return "IE"; //InternetExplor
  }
  else if(isFirefox=navigator.userAgent.indexOf("Firefox")>0){
     return "FF"; //firefox
  }
  else if(isSafari=navigator.userAgent.indexOf("Safari")>0) {
     return "SF"; //Safari
  }
  else if(isCamino=navigator.userAgent.indexOf("Camino")>0){
     return "C"; //Camino
  }
  else if(isMozilla=navigator.userAgent.indexOf("Gecko/")>0){
     return "G"; //Gecko
  }
  else if(isMozilla=navigator.userAgent.indexOf("Opera")>=0){
     return "O"; //opera
  }else{
    return 'Other';
  }
}
function alert_br(){
  var os=getOs();
  if(os=='FF' || os=='SF'){ //FireFox、谷歌浏览器用这个
    alert('第一行
第二行');
  }else{  //IE系列用这个
    alert('第一行
\n第二行);
  }
}
alert_br();

Der zweite ist relativ einfach, kann den IE jedoch nur leicht von anderen Browsern unterscheiden:

function alert_br(){
  if(!document.all)//FF/{谷歌浏览器用这个
    alert('第一行
第二行');
  }else{  //IE系列用这个
    alert('第一行
\n第二行);
  }
}
alert_br();

Ich hoffe, dass dieser Artikel für alle hilfreich ist, die sich mit der JavaScript-Programmierung befassen.

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n